  • Can't go wrong with a DVX

    Excellent prosumer camera. There should be a class like "Almost Pro" for this cam. Have been using it for a couple of months now. Total control of the image you get, full auto works very well also. Am surprised how light and balanced it feels for hand-held shooting. 60i is definately broadcast quality. 24p looks great with soooooo much image control. Best bang-for-buck standard definition camera you can get. Only two negatives so far. 1) 10x zoom is a little short, but you might not need more for your projects. Add on lenses don't do much for it either. 2) Little knob-type-control-thingy for the VCR and menu navigation has to go. Really bad. But, then again, I've yet to see this type of control done well and ANY camera. All-in-all, if you're in this ...

  • The Best MiniDV Camcorder In Its Class

    This camera is about $1000 less than a Canon XL-2, but it betters that camera in picture quality, picture quality controls, viewfinder, connectability - in fact, the only thing that the XL-2 has better is interchangeable lenses. How often will you need that? Probably never. This camera has an excellent picture, XLR audio inputs, actual controls on the camera body, not buried in menu screens. It has a responsive manual zoom, variable zoom speed control, well-placed control knobs. It's designed like a pro camera with white balance, audio levels, color bars, even a time date stamp optional. It has a Leica lens! I use mine for legal video, depositions and field inspections; it goes anywhere. Check out this three-way match-up between the three cameras in this price class at DVX User: ...

  • King camera

    I love my dvx100b. This camera is the best standard definition on the market. The 24p mode is a very nice addition. I know that this camera won't measure up to the real professional cameras, but for the money, this camera can't be beat. It really all depends on what you were used to before you bought this camera. A very nice piece of equipment especially for serious hobbyists, indy filmmakers on a budget, and wedding videographers. The internal mic is nothing special, but every serious videographer know that you rely on the xlr inputs, not the internal mic. The only thing I would prefer would be for it to be sdhc card cable instead of transfering video to editing consoles via firewire. That said, the firewire transfer works great once you get used to its operation and this camera ...
